* About the Role:

*
* As a CBRE People Business Partner, you will assist with theroll-out and communication of HR initiatives, policies, and procedures.

This job is part of the People Strategy and Operations function. They are responsible for the design, execution, and monitoring ofhuman resource programs and policies.

** What You'll Do:*
* + Assist     with the development of onboarding, career ladders, succession planning,     and performance management initiatives in the organization.

+ Provide     employee relations guidance, conflict resolution, and assist with issuing     disciplinary action and performance improvement counseling.

+ Work     with managers to identify employment-related risks and begin the discovery     process of investigations and grievances.

+ Manage     several HR functions such as employment, labor relations, compensation,     etc. for a business unit or line of business.

+ Conduct     training on a variety of topics including performance management,     diversity, and more.

+ Apply     in-depth knowledge of standard principles and techniques/procedures to     accomplish complex assignments and provide innovative solutions.

+ Coach     others and share in-depth knowledge of own job discipline and broad     knowledge of several job disciplines within the function.

+ Lead     by example and model behaviors that are consistent with CBRE RISE values.
Work to build consensus and convince others to reach an agreement.

+ Impact     a range of customer, operational, project, or service activities within     own team and other related teams.

+ Work     within broad guidelines and policies.

+ Explain     difficult or sensitive information.

+ Travel     to our sites which could be up to 30% monthly - drive and some overnight     trips.

** What You'll Need:*
* + Bachelor's     Degree preferred with 5-8 years of relevant experience. In lieu of a     degree, a combination of experience and education will be considered.

+ Ability     to exercise judgment based on the analysis of multiple sources of     information.

+ Willingness     to take a new perspective on existing solutions.

+ In-depth     knowledge of Microsoft Office products. Examples include Word, Excel,     Outlook, etc.

+ Organizational     skills with an advanced inquisitive mindset.

+ Sophisticated     math skills. Ability to calculate mildly complex figures such as     percentages, fractions, and other financial-related calculations.
